jana_utils_time_diff ()

void
jana_utils_time_diff (JanaTime *t1,
                      JanaTime *t2,
                      gint *year,
                      gint *month,
                      gint *day,
                      gint *hours,
                      gint *minutes,
                      glong *seconds);

Gets the difference between two times. Times are compared so that if t2 is later than t1 , the difference is positive. If a parameter is ommitted, the result will be accumulated in the next nearest parameter. For example, if there were a years difference between t1 and t2 , but the year parameter was ommitted, the month parameter will accumulate 12 months. This function takes into account the relative time offsets of t1 and t2 , so no prior conversion is required.

Parameters

t1

A JanaTime

 

t2

A JanaTime

 

year

Return location for difference in years, or NULL

 

month

Return location for difference in months, or NULL

 

day

Return location for difference in days, or NULL

 

hours

Return location for difference in hours, or NULL

 

minutes

Return location for difference in minutes, or NULL

 

seconds

Return location for difference in seconds, or NULL

 

jana_utils_time_adjust ()

void
jana_utils_time_adjust (JanaTime *time,
                        gint year,
                        gint month,
                        gint day,
                        gint hours,
                        gint minutes,
                        gint seconds);

A convenience function to adjust a time by a specified amount on each field. The time will be adjusted in the order seconds, minutes, hours, days, months and years. It is important to take into account how a time may be normalised when adjusting. This function can be used in conjunction with jana_utils_time_diff() to adjust one time to be equal to another, while taking time offsets into account.

Parameters

time

A JanaTime

 

year

Years to add to time

 

month

Months to add to time

 

day

Days to add to time

 

hours

Hours to add to time

 

minutes

Minutes to add to time

 

seconds

Seconds to add to time

jana_utils_event_get_instances ()

GList *
jana_utils_event_get_instances (JanaEvent *event,
                                JanaTime *range_start,
                                JanaTime *range_end,
                                glong offset);

Splits an event across each day it occurs, taking into account offset , and returns a list of JanaDuration's for each day it occurs. The first and last instances have their start and end adjusted correctly. If the event doesn't occur over more than one day, the list will contain just one duration whose start and end match the start and end of the event, adjusted by offset . If range_end is NULL and event has an indefinite recurrence, the recurrence will be ignored. This is to avoid infinite loops; it is discouraged to call this function without bounds.

Parameters

event

A JanaEvent

 

range_start

The start boundary for instances, or NULL for no boundary

 

range_end

The end boundary for instances, or NULL for no boundary

 

offset

The offset, in seconds, to offset the event by

 

Returns

A list of JanaDuration's for each day event occurs. This list should be freed with jana_utils_instance_list_free().
